After the huge success of the Ray-Ban collaboration, Meta brings its smartglass technology to Oakley with a new range of performance eyewear. The Oakley Meta HSTN brings a number of upgrades that include a 40% longer battery life with up to eight hours of use, a charging case with 48 hours of battery life, a higher resolution 3K camera, and a selection of Oakley’s proprietary Prizm lenses.
Everything on the Oakley Meta HSTN works just like the Ray-Ban model with built-in microphones and speakers that let you use your voice to activate Meta’s AI assistant for accessing real time information as well as controlling features like playing your music or recording video. Oakley Meta HSTN will launch in six frame options on July 11th for $399.
